Thanks for the offer, fortunately I have figured out the problem: Improper reading of the documentation lead me to believe that for get_var(name,start,count,data) count would define the end-corner (like start defines the start-corner), when it really describes the "thickness" of the slab. With proper usage of count/get_var all my problems have disappeared. Cheers, Thomas
